Solution Overview
Problem
Current graphical user interfaces (GUIs) for handheld electronic devices require separate modules for adjusting volume and vibration settings, which can be inconvenient for users as they need to navigate through multiple interfaces to configure notification preferences.
Innovation Solution
A unified notification module is introduced that combines volume, vibration, and combination vibration and volume settings, allowing users to adjust these settings in a single interface displayed on the device's screen, using touch-sensitive controls or navigational tools like a trackball, enabling intuitive selection and adjustment of notification intensities.

A system and method for adjusting a notification setting of a handheld electronic device is provided. The method includes receiving a request to adjust a notification setting which causes the electronic device to display a notification module on a display of the electronic device. The notification module includes a plurality of control portions each corresponding to a notification setting which can be adjusted within the corresponding control portion. The method further includes detecting a selection proximate to a control portion and inputting a notification setting change based upon a selection executed within one of the control portions. The notification setting is adjusted in response to the notification setting change.
